Nearby Hospitals
Source: CMS Hospital CompareNearest Hospitals
5
With Emergency Services
5
Avg CMS Rating
2.8 / 5
Nearest Hospital
13.1 mi
Kent County Memorial Hospital
| Hospital | Distance | Type | Rating | ER |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Kent County Memorial Hospital | 13.1 mi | Acute Care Hospitals | 2/5 | ✓ |
| Day Kimball Hospital | 13.3 mi | Acute Care Hospitals | 3/5 | ✓ |
| Roger Williams Medical Center | 13.9 mi | Acute Care Hospitals | 3/5 | ✓ |
| Providence Va Medical Center | 13.9 mi | Acute Care - Veterans Administration | 3/5 | ✓ |
| Women & Infants Hospital Of Rhode Island | 15.3 mi | Acute Care Hospitals | 3/5 | ✓ |
Clayville has an obesity rate of 31.7%, which is 4.4pp below the national average. The depression rate is 23.2%, near the national average. About 4.7% of adults lack health insurance. 85.7% of residents had an annual checkup in the past year. There are 5 hospitals nearby. 5 offer emergency services. The average CMS quality rating is 2.8 out of 5.
